What is the SI base unit for mass?
Gram
Pound
Kilogram
Ounce
Correct Answer:
C. Kilogram
Detailed Explanation
The SI base unit for mass is the kilogram. It is the standard unit used in science and international measurements. While grams and other units are also used, the kilogram is the main unit in the International System of Units (SI). One kilogram equals 1000 grams. Pounds and ounces are not part of the SI system and are mostly used in countries like the United States. Therefore, the correct answer is kilogram.
